From the reviews: "The aim of the present book is to give an introduction to this very active area of investigation. ... the book is of great help for graduate and postgraduate students, as well as for researchers interested in fixed point theory, geometry of Banach spaces and numerical solution of various kinds of equations - operator differential equations, differential inclusions, variational inequalities." (S. Cobzas, Studia Universitatis Babes-Bolyai. Mathematica, Vol. LIV (4), December, 2009) "The topic of this monograph falls within the area of nonlinear functional analysis. ... The main purpose of this book is to expose in depth the most important results on iterative algorithms for approximation of fixed points or zeroes of the mappings mentioned above. ... this book picks up the most important results in the area, its explanations are comprehensive and interesting and I think that this book will be useful for mathematicians interested in iterations for nonlinear operators defined in Banach spaces." (Jesus Garcia-Falset, Mathematical Reviews, Issue 2010 f)
